Order dates (khajoor) by the name on the listing — Ajwa, Mabroom, Sukkary, Kalmi or a gift box — then confirm the box or kilo size on the product page.
Pakistani homes buy khajoor for iftar, guests and gifts. Khan Dry Fruit groups them under Dates, with sub-collections for named styles.

If the pack is Ajwa, the product name will include Ajwa. Same for Mabroom, Sukkary, Kalmi and Mazafati. We do not relabel a generic date as Ajwa.
Saudi-style and Iranian dry dates have their own collections: Saudi Arabian Dates and Dry Irani Dates.
A small box suits a few iftar evenings. A larger box or kilo listing suits a family that finishes dates quickly. Compare photos and weight on each page.

If Medjool is in a product title, that page is the listing. Search the Dates category for the exact name.
Keep the box closed. Soft dates often keep better cool; dry dates prefer a cupboard away from steam. Follow any note on the pack.
